Wright Canada Holdings, Ltd.

Title: Recruiting Specialist

Pay Type: Full-time, Salaried

Location: Calgary, AB

Remote Type: Hybrid (2 days in office, 3 days remote following training period)

Reports To: Recruiting Manager

About Wright Canada Holdings:

Wright Canada Holdings is employee-owned company formed in 2017. Wright Canada Holdings is a prominent leader in several environmental services industries, representing our family of companies across Canada and is comprised of Spectrum Resource Group, Wright Tree Service of Canada, ArborCare® and CNUC of Canada.

Our operations and clientele stretch across Canada from British Columbia to New Brunswick. Together as a family of companies, we provide integrated vegetation management, consulting and operations, and other outdoor services in Canada.

Job Summary: The Recruiting Specialist is responsible for conducting ongoing recruitment activities for positions under Hiring Managers within assigned company/division while working under the direction of the Recruiting Manager for Wright Canada Holdings.

Essential Job Functions: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ential job functions:

  • Coordinate recruiting processes for a designated company/division by communicating frequently with hiring managers to understand workforce needs.

  • Identify and implement efficient and effective recruiting methods based on the needs of the company/division and industry standards.

  • Collaborate with hiring managers to maintain detailed and accurate job postings and hiring criteria.

  • Compile and analyze data to make recommendations regarding the most cost-efficient advertising sources to utilize for recruiting.

  • Initiate job requisitions for open positions within the Human Resource Information System.

  • Coordinate job postings within the Human Resource Information System and place and monitor job postings/advertisements across other channels (online media and print).

  • Screen candidates and select qualified candidates for interviews with hiring managers. Verifies candidate credentials, including experience, certificates, and references.

  • Coordinate and assist with the interview process, attending and conducting interviews with hiring managers and other stakeholders, as necessary.

  • Coordinate the preparation of interview questions and other hiring and selection materials.

  • Initiatives employment offers under direction of HR Manager and hiring managers using defined business processes and templates in the Human Resource Information System.

  • Provides candidate follow-up communications regarding offer and next steps or declined for position.

  • Coordinates all pre-employment checks under direction and per policies from HR and Safety/Risk and utilizing the Human Resource Information System or associated systems as determined.

  • Actively onboards and orients employees and maintains consistent communication with hiring managers and employees.

  • Attend job fairs, campus events, and other networking opportunities to attract candidates and improve and grow the company’s/division’s network and recruitment brand.

  • Comply with laws and regulations and company policies and processes in the application of recruiting practices and programs to ensure legal, fair, and consistent hiring.

  • Perform administrative assistant duties for company/division operations leadership as needed.
